Research Senior Technician

The Research Senior Technician provides advanced, independent support for federally funded and institutionally sponsored research studies within the Ewing Research Lab, with a primary focus on cancer prevention, health disparities, and digital health interventions. This position plays a central role in the day-to-day coordination and execution of research activities, including participant recruitment and outreach, data collection and management, regulatory documentation, and study operations across multiple concurrent projects. The Research Senior Technician works closely with the Principal Investigator and interdisciplinary research team to ensure studies are conducted in accordance with approved protocols, timelines, and regulatory requirements.

Key responsibilities include coordinating participant engagement efforts (e.g., outreach, screening, consent, scheduling), supporting community-engaged and participant-centered research activities, including culturally responsive outreach and engagement strategies, managing study materials and incentives, maintaining accurate research records, and overseeing data entry and quality assurance using platforms such as REDCap and secure institutional databases. The Research Senior Technician supports IRB submissions and modifications, prepares study documentation, assists with protocol implementation, and monitors study progress to identify and resolve operational issues. This role requires independent judgment, strong organizational skills, and the ability to prioritize competing deadlines while maintaining compliance with institutional policies and sponsor expectations.

In addition, the Research Senior Technician contributes to broader research team functions by assisting with training and mentoring of students or hourly staff, supporting preparation of reports and presentations, and facilitating communication among internal and external collaborators. Assist with onboarding and task-level training of students or hourly staff as assigned (does not include formal supervision). The position requires demonstrated experience in human subjects research, familiarity with research compliance standards, and the ability to work both independently and collaboratively in a fast-paced academic research environment. The Research Senior Technician is expected to exercise discretion, professionalism, and initiative while supporting the labs mission to advance high-quality, community-engaged research.

This role offers opportunities for professional growth through involvement in publications, grant activities, and advanced research operations.

Required Qualifications:

  • High school diploma or GED + 4 years of relevant experience OR
  • Associates degree + 2 years of relevant experience OR
  • Bachelors degree (no experience required)

Pay Range: $19.28 - $22

Salary will be based off of education, experience, internal equity, and budget allowance.

This is a part time 20 hour a week term position.

This position is contingent upon funding and will end on or before December 31, 2029, with possibility of renewal based on continued availability of funding and performance.
